Padilla found guilty

The jury returned a verdict today in the case against Jose Padilla and his two co-defendants.

The charges:
Count 1 - Conspiracy to Murder, Kidnap, and Maim Persons in a Foreign Country as part of a conspiracy to advance violent jihad
Count 2 - Conspiracy to Provide Material Support for Terrorists
Count 3 - Material Support for Terrorists
Counts 4 and 5 are against Hassoun for unlawful possession of a weapon and making a false statement
Counts 6 through 10 are against Hassoun for multiple charges of perjury
Count 11 is against Hassoun for obstruction

Michelle Malkin has the timeline leading up to the scumbag's involvement with Al Qaeda and designation as an "enemy combatant" by President Bush, as well as his Al Qaeda "application form" (I never knew Al Qaeda bothered with a paper trail, but skip on over to Michelle's blog to see it for yourself):
May 1988: Padilla turns 18, released from juvenile detention in Chicago on probation until age 21.

October 1991: Padilla arrested in South Florida on gun and traffic charges. He serves 10 months in prison.

Early 1993: Padilla, while employed at Taco Bell in Davie, FL, inquires about converting to Islam.

1994: Padilla begins using the name Ibrahim.

1998: Padilla leaves U.S. to study Arabic abroad.

1999: Padilla travels to Afghanistan.

2001: Padilla meets with Abu Zubaydah. Padilla and an unnamed associate receive explosives training in Pakistan.

Early 2002: Padilla meets with Khalid Shaikh Mohammed and is ordered to return to the U.S. for reasons still unclear.

May 2002: Padilla arrested on a material witness warrant related to September 11, at Chicago’s O’Hare International Airport.

June 2002:Padilla designated “enemy combatant” by the president and moved to military custody in South Carolina.

    It's been all over the news that Al Qaeda is gathering strength and still wants to attack the United States:

    Al-Qaida is stepping up its efforts to sneak terror operatives into the United States and has acquired most of the capabilities it needs to strike here, according to a new U.S. intelligence assessment, The Associated Press has learned.

    The draft National Intelligence Estimate is expected to paint an ever-more-worrisome portrait of al-Qaida’s ability to use its base along the Pakistan-Afghan border to launch and inspire attacks, even as Bush administration officials say the U.S. is safer nearly six years into the war on terror.

    The document also discusses increasing concern about individuals already inside the United States who are adopting an extremist brand of Islam.

    Government officials, who spoke on condition of anonymity because the report has not been finalized, described it as an expansive look at potential threats within the United States and said it required the cooperation of a number of national security agencies, including the CIA, FBI, Homeland Security Department and National Counterterrorism Center.

    At a news conference Thursday, President Bush acknowledged al-Qaida’s continuing threat to the United States and used the new report as evidence his administration’s policies are on the right course.

    “The same folks that are bombing innocent people in Iraq were the ones who attacked us in America on Sept. 11,” he said. “That’s why what happens in Iraq matters to security here at home.”
